National Council For Co-operative Training (ncct) announces a tender for ANNUAL MAINTENANCE SERVICES FOR WATER PURIFICATION AND CONDITIONING SYSTEM (Version 2) - Drinking Water Cooler; 3 to 5; PACKAGE-1: Water purifier and conditioning system maintenance involving basic servicing in CHANDIGARH, CHANDIGARH. Quantity: 6. Submission Deadline: 21-04-2025 21: 00: 00. Last date to apply is approaching fast!
